Kumbia Race Club Mid-Year Meeting
The Kumbia Racing Club will be holding their brand new Mid-Year Meeting at the Kumbia racetrack from around 11:00am this morning through until 5:00pm this afternoon (the first race leaves the barriers at 1:05pm). This brand new 5-card event was given to the club by Premier Campbell Newman at last year's Melbourne Cup Day race meeting and is a very welcome addition to the South Burnett's annual racing calendar. As usual, the Kumbia trackside will be dotted with tents and picnicers enjoying the relaxed country racing atmosphere, and the meeting will have a licensed bar, BBQ, and the Luncheon Hall in operation, along with full Sky-TV race meeting coverage and a vigorous betting ring. Admission is just $10 for adults and $5 for concessions, and everyone is welcome (you can dress up for race day too, if you like - it's a bit of a Kumbia tradition!). More details? Nanango Country Markets
The Nanango Show Society will be holding their regular monthly Country Markets at the Nanango Showgrounds in Cairns Street from 6:00am to around 12:00 noon today. As usual, the markets will feature a wide variety of craft stalls, new and used goods, plants, poultry and pets. The Nanango Markets are the largest rural market in south east Queensland and routinely attract 320 to 420 stallholders. But new stallholders are always very welcome too! More info? Rural Fire Service Day
Today is Rural Fire Service Day in Queensland, an opportunity to celebrate the dedication and commitment of the 34,000 men and women who volunteer in local brigades to help keep Queensland safe. A number of the South Burnett's rural fire brigades are having open days or displays to celebrate, and the public are very welcome to come along to any of them to meet the firies, thank them for the wondefful work they do in our region and even sign aboard themseves if they want: South Nanango - at the Nanango markets; Cloyna - 4:00pm-7:00pm at the fire shed, 42 West Road, Cloyna; McEuen - at the fire shed, 474 Cushnie Road, Wondai; Ballogie, Coverty, Durong and Glencoe - a combvined display by all four brigades from 8:00am to 2:00pm at the Ballogie fire shed on the Chinchilla-Wondai Road; Widgee - at the Widgee markets at the Widgee General Store, Gympie-Woolooga Road

Art Exhibition Opening - Wondai
The Wondai Regional Art Gallery on the roundabout at Wondai will be hosting a special two day exhibition by South Burnett artist Lee Porter from 10:00am to 4:00pm today and tomorrow. The exhibition is "Can You See What I See?" and it features paintings of animals which convey human-like expressions and/or emotions in their eyes. The exhibition will be travelling to Florence, Italy in July at the invitation of Gallery360, and this weekend's showing is to allow South Burnett residents to see it before the Italians do (since it will be representing our region in one of the world's art capitals). Admission to view it is free. An official opening will also be held at the Gallery at 6:00pm this evening, and everyone is welcome along. More details? Phone the Gallery on (07) 4168-5926.
